What is ADHD?
ADHD is a neurodevelopmental disorder identified by consistent patterns of inattention, impulsivity, and hyperactivity. While it is commonly diagnosed in kids, research suggests that lots of individuals bring these signs into adulthood, impacting their personal and professional lives.

Diagnosis of ADHD in Adults in the UK
The diagnosis of ADHD in grownups generally involves numerous steps and can in some cases be daunting. Below is a brief outline of the diagnostic procedure:
1. Initial Assessment
The initial step is typically an initial evaluation by a healthcare professional, who will perform an extensive review of the person’s case history, symptoms, and any previous examinations.
2. Diagnostic Criteria
In the UK, the diagnosis normally follows standards from the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ders (DSM-5) or International Classification of Diseases (ICD-11). The key requirements include:

4. Exclusion of Other Conditions
A crucial part of the diagnosis involves ruling out other psychological health conditions that might mimic ADHD symptoms, such as stress and anxiety conditions, depression, or learning disabilities.
5. Diagnosis Confirmation
When all assessments are total, a certified specialist will make a formal diagnosis based upon the collected information. If identified, a treatment strategy will be discussed.

Can ADHD be diagnosed in grownups?
Yes, ADHD can be diagnosed in adults, although numerous people might not get a Diagnosis Of ADHD In Adults until later on in life.
